    why is cyanide used in gold mining?

    Cyanide is widely used in gold mining due to its ability to extract gold from ore efficiently. The process, known as cyanidation, involves crushing the ore into a fine powder and mixing it with water and a weak cyanide solution. The gold particles then combine with the cyanide, forming a soluble compound known as a complex. This complex can then be easily separated from the ore, resulting in the extraction of gold.

    risks associated with
    cyanide usage:

    While cyanide is an effective means of extracting gold, its toxicity is a major concern for the environment and the health of the surrounding communities. Cyanide can contaminate water bodies, leading to severe ecological impacts. It is highly toxic to aquatic life, interfering with their respiration and metabolic processes, and can cause long-term damage to ecosystems.

    Moreover, cyanide can pose a significant health risk to humans if not handled and contained properly. Exposure to high levels of cyanide can lead to acute poisoning, causing symptoms such as headaches, dizziness, nausea, and even death. Long-term exposure may result in chronic health problems, including neurological disorders, respiratory issues, and various forms of cancer.
